Output 66e49891b09baa8f0da67013568ff8ae0d6d62e28f3d278e029866d45f1f1a0d:23

value
1386
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ba539136e44c35abb0d41dab2dd5e7406c99ab1bdf62a7fa5172fbbc86eb911a
address
bc1phffezdhyfs66hvx5rk4jm408gpkfn2cmma3207j3wtamephtjydqnwy4hj
transaction
66e49891b09baa8f0da67013568ff8ae0d6d62e28f3d278e029866d45f1f1a0d
spent
true